<h2> What is SIMOS and How Does It Work in Vehicle Diagnostics? </h2> <a href="https://www.aliexpress.com/item/1005009339091994.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/S8d9cd8155fd54797b9580efb300a6953h.jpg" alt="PCR2.1 Immo Remover Software PCR 2.1 Unlimited Verison IMMO OFF Fix SIMOS for VAG ECU No Checksum Correction Algorithm SOFTWARE"> </a> SIMOS, short for Siemens Motor Control, is a widely used engine control unit (ECU) system developed by Siemens. It is commonly found in various automotive applications, particularly in European and Asian vehicles. The SIMOS ECU is responsible for managing critical engine functions such as fuel injection, ignition timing, and emissions control. Understanding how SIMOS works is essential for mechanics and vehicle owners who want to perform accurate diagnostics and repairs. The SIMOS system is known for its advanced control algorithms and compatibility with a wide range of vehicle models. It is often used in conjunction with other ECU systems like MEDC17, EDC16, and MED9, which are also popular in the automotive industry. These systems are typically found in diesel and gasoline engines, and they require specialized diagnostic tools for proper maintenance and troubleshooting. SIMOS, MEDC17, and EDC16 are three of the most common ECU systems found in modern vehicles. Understanding the differences between these systems can help you choose the right diagnostic tools and software for your specific needs. SIMOS, as mentioned earlier, is a Siemens-developed ECU system that is widely used in European and Asian vehicles. It is known for its advanced control algorithms and compatibility with a wide range of vehicle models. SIMOS is often used in both diesel and gasoline engines, and it is particularly popular in BMW, Volkswagen, and other European brands. MEDC17 is another ECU system that is commonly found in European vehicles, especially those manufactured by Volkswagen and Audi. Like SIMOS, MEDC17 is used in both diesel and gasoline engines, and it offers similar functionality in terms of engine control and diagnostics. However, MEDC17 is generally considered to be a more advanced system, with improved fuel efficiency and emissions control. EDC16 is a Bosch-developed ECU system that is primarily used in diesel engines. It is known for its high level of precision and reliability, making it a popular choice for commercial and heavy-duty vehicles. EDC16 is also used in some passenger vehicles, particularly those with turbocharged diesel engines. One of the key advantages of EDC16 is its ability to handle high-pressure fuel injection systems, which are common in modern diesel engines. While these ECU systems share some similarities, they also have distinct differences in terms of design, functionality, and compatibility. For example, SIMOS and MEDC17 are both used in gasoline and diesel engines, but they have different control strategies and software architectures. EDC16, on the other hand, is primarily used in diesel engines and is optimized for high-pressure fuel injection systems. Proper maintenance of the vehicle's electrical system is also crucial for maintaining SIMOS ECU systems. This includes checking and replacing worn or damaged wiring, ensuring that all electrical connections are secure, and monitoring the vehicle's battery health. A weak or failing battery can cause the ECU to malfunction, leading to performance issues and potential damage to the system. Regularly inspecting and maintaining the electrical system can help prevent these issues and ensure that the ECU continues to function properly.
